What is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ract?

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ract, also known as licorice root extract, is derived from the roots of the Glycyrrhiza glabra plant, a legume native to Southern Europe and parts of Asia. This plant is more commonly known as licorice, and its roots have been utilized for centuries in traditional medicine for their extensive health benefits.

Don’t be deceived by its exotic scientific title—this extract is a frequently employed powerhouse in the cosmetics industry. Its general purpose within skincare and beauty products is multifaceted. It is recognized for its skin-soothing properties, smoothing and emollient capabilities, and even its bleaching effect.

Regarding bleaching, it is a natural alternative to chemical skin-lightening agents by inhibiting the enzyme that causes skin darkening in response to sun exposure.

The concentration of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ract in cosmetic products can vary widely depending on the product’s function and formulation. It can be incorporated into a broad formulation of ingredients or procured as a stand-alone product, particularly in serums targeting specific skin concerns.

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ract Skin Benefits

Unveiling the skin benefits of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ract feels akin to opening a treasure chest of skincare gems. Here’s a look at some of the key benefits that make this ingredient a prized component of many cosmetic formulations.

  • Bleaching / Skin Brightening: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ract is rich in a compound called glabridin, inhibiting melanin production, helping to lighten skin tone and diminish the appearance of dark spots and hyperpigmentation. Unlike chemical bleaching agents, this natural derivative does this without causing harmful side effects or skin damage. It’s a gentle alternative for those seeking a brighter complexion and even skin tone.
  • Emollient: As an emollient,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ract helps create a protective barrier on the skin’s surface. This prevents moisture loss from the deeper layers of the skin, ensuring lasting hydration and smooth texture. Maintaining the skin’s moisture balance keeps the skin looking fresh and healthy without directly impacting its condition or appearance.
  • Skin Conditioning and Smoothing: Rich in antioxidants and phytosterols,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ract helps improve skin elasticity, making it smoother and softer to the touch. It enhances hydration levels, repairing dry and flaky skin and replenishing suppleness.
  • Soothing: Licorice root extract is known for its potent anti-inflammatory properties. It helps calm irritated skin, soothe redness, and reduce inflammation. This is particularly beneficial for sensitive skin types and conditions like rosacea and acne.

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ract Potential Side Effects

It’s worth noting that, like any cosmetic ingredient, side effects and reactions to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ract can vary significantly from person to person. This variance is primarily due to the unique nature of our skin, which can be influenced by numerous factors, including our skin type, genetic factors, environmental influences, and overall health. If you’re not certain about your skin type, consult this helpful guide to find your skin type.

Potential side effects and interactions, although rare, might include:

  • Irritation or Allergic Reactions: Some people may experience skin irritation or allergic reactions such as redness, itching, or swelling. This is more likely to occur in individuals with sensitive skin or those allergic to the licorice plant.
  • Hormonal Fluctuations: As the licorice root extract contains a component called glycyrrhizin, there are concerns that high or prolonged use may impact hormone levels. However, this is more common with oral consumption than topical application.

If one were to experience any of these side effects, it’s vital to discontinue the use of the product immediately and consult a healthcare professional or dermatologist. They can provide helpful advice concerning the adverse reaction and guide how to proceed.

Remember that adverse reactions to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ract are rare. Generally speaking, the ingredient is safe and effective when used as directed.

Comedogenic Rating

Regarding its comedogenicity, or the ability to block pores and potentially cause acne,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ract sits comfortably at a 0 – this rating signifies that it’s non-comedogenic and unlikely to clog your pores, leading to potential breakouts.

The reason for this low rating lies in its natural composition. Glycyrrhiza Glabra Root Extract doesn’t contain heavy oils or elements that could contribute to pore congestion. Moreover, its anti-inflammatory properties can be an ally to acne-prone skin by helping to soothe and reduce acne-related redness and inflammation. Therefore, this ingredient is generally safe and suitable for individuals prone to breakouts or acne.
